Property summary
This exceptional 17,678 square foot commercial property presents a unique investment opportunity in the heart of Gaithersburg, Maryland. Situated on a 0.41-acre lot at the corner of North Summit Avenue and Lee Street, this site boasts a highly desirable Central Business District (CBD) zoning designation from the City of Gaithersburg. This zoning allows for a variety of development options, including townhome construction, retail establishments, or office space, providing significant flexibility for the discerning investor.
